Core Tip |
Hepatitis B viral (HBV) infection is responsible for different types of cancer. However, its role in pancreatic ductal adenocarcinoma (PDAC) remains unclear. This study aimed to assess the prevalence of previous HBV infection (PBI) and to identify viral biomarkers in patients with PDAC to support the role of the virus in etiology of this cancer. We found almost three-fold risks of PDAC in antibody to hepatitis B core antigen-positive patients. Detection of viral replication and HBx protein expression in the tumor tissue prove a possible involvement of HBV infection in pancreatic cancer development. PBI is currently an underestimated cause of PDAC. |
